用maven找不到jena.db包

时间:2014-08-09 11:07:35

标签: java maven jena

我和jena有点问题。我想在我的一个项目中使用https://github.com/ldodds/slug。这个应用程序没有依赖项,所以我使用Maven来收集这个应用程序需要的东西。除了一个包

之外,Maven解决了所有问题
import com.hp.hpl.jena.db.*;

我无法用任何jena maven存储库来解决它。你知道我在哪里找到它吗?也许jena.db在较旧的软件包中可用,但我找不到有关此软件包的任何迁移指南。

如果您熟悉问题或了解Jena结构,请提供帮助。

提前致谢。

1 个答案:

答案 0 :(得分:2)

RDB存储层(包com.hp.hpl.jena.db)已经从Jena中删除了很长时间。据推测,slug可以使用它的lib目录中的版本。

最好使用TDB或概括并使用SPARQL(查询和更新),这样它就可以使用外部的标准三重存储(如Jena Fuseki - 有很多可供选择)。它需要更改slug。